Vitamins and Minerals
Fajita Peppers & Onions contains several essential vitamins and minerals such as Vitamin C, Vitamin K, and Potassium. Bell peppers are a great source of Vitamin C, which helps boost the immune system and repair skin cells. Onions contain Vitamin K, which aids in blood coagulation and bone health. Potassium helps regulate blood pressure and prevent stroke or heart attacks.
Health Benefits of Peppers and Onions
Peppers and onions are healthy vegetables that offer a variety of health benefits. Bell peppers are low in calories and rich in antioxidants that reduce inflammation and the risk of chronic diseases. Onions also contain antioxidants and flavonoids that help in fighting inflammation and reducing the risk of cancer and heart disease.

5. How can I make Fajita Peppers & Onions at home?
To make Fajita Peppers & Onions at home, slice 2-3 bell peppers and 1 onion into thin strips. Heat a tablespoon of oil in a pan over medium-high heat and add the vegetables. Cook until they are tender and charred, stirring occasionally. Add in any desired seasonings such as cumin, chili powder, or garlic powder. Serve hot and enjoy!
